You got me M.
1969 735 Bright Blue Cloth bench seat 53 Glacier Blue 50 Dover White 1970 731 Black vinyl standard bench 45 Green Mist 45 Green Mist 1970 740 Medium Gold cloth bench seat 50 Gobi Beige 50 Gobi Beige 1971 753 Black Custom vinyl bench seat 26 Mulsanne Blue B Black vinyl top |

Re: Trim numbers and PNT numbers for Novas
I think so Jason. I have seen vinyl top codes 1-4 in print before but not 5 or 6. 1=white, 2=black, 3=green, 4=blue. At least for 68 models anyway. Everything else on that 68 was gold so I guess the top could have been as well.

Re: Trim numbers and PNT numbers for Novas
You could order hugger orange in late 70. It was called a spring time offering along with citrus green, and sunflower yellow.
In 69 you had to special order the h/o on novas --. We have a 69-- h/o L78 nova in the shop now that belongs to a member here. It has a black vinyl top, but we believe that may have been dealer installed. Sold new from Grossman. |
